Intro & New Features
Introducing the cutting-edge Bauer Vapor HyperLite 2 hockey helmet, a pinnacle of advanced technology and uncompromising protection. Designed with the best that Bauer has to offer, this exceptional helmet incorporates a range of innovative features to prioritize both comfort and safety, including all-new GX-Cell technology, DCT padding and liner, an Aerolite base, and an adjustable occipital lock.
Outer Shell Construction
The helmet base is made with Aerolite technology, an innovative 3D wrap that offers a contoured fit around the head for a closer fit while still minimizing uncomfortable pressure points. The Aerolite base also excels at mitigating high-energy impacts, providing an added layer of protection to keep players safe during intense gameplay.
Internal Foams & Liner
Bauer’s biggest innovation for this helmet lies in the inside of the helmet along the liner. Strategically positioned GX-Cell pods are 3D-printed pods and meticulously designed to maximize energy absorption in areas most prone to impacts, offering unparalleled protection against head injuries. These advanced pods focus on mitigating the force of rotational impacts for better safety on the ice, in addition to featuring integrated air channels for better ventilation.
Fit & Sizing Adjustment
With the FreeForm Adjustment system, every player can fine-tune the helmet's fit to their unique preferences. This advanced adjustment system has been upgraded from previous models, like the RE-AKT 150 or RE-AKT 85, and is designed to fit every head shape and keep the helmet secure on your head. This system is coupled with an occipital lock, which further ensures an Elite-level fit that keeps the helmet securely in place. It is suggested that the dials on the Freeform Adjustment System be adjusted first before fixing the Occipital Lock in place.
Certification
The Hyperlite 2 helmet is certified with HECC (Hockey Equipment Certification Council), CSA (Canadian Standards Association), UKCA (United Kingdom Conformity Assesed) and CE (European Community) certification. These stickers indicate their compliance with the applicable standards in different leagues.
Sizes & Colors
The Hyperlite 2 comes in sizes S/M and M/L in the following colourways: Black, Blue, Navy, Red, and White.

Feature | Description |
---|---|
Category | Elite |
External Material | Aerolite |
Occipital Adjustment | Occipital Lock |
Tool Free Adjustment | Yes |
Internal Foams | GX-Cell Pods | DCT Foam |
Liner | Thermocore Zero Line |
Made In | Thailand |
Cage | Carbon Steel Oval Wire |
Certification | CSA, HECC, CE, UKCA |
Warranty | 1 Year |
Sizes | S/M, M/L |
Weight | 515g |
Helmet Size | Hat Size | Head Circumference (cm) |
---|---|---|
Small / Medium | 6 ¾" - 7 ⅜ | 54.0 - 59.0 cm |
Medium / Large | 7 ⅛ - 7 ⅞ | 57.0 - 62.5 cm |
Hockey Helmet Sizing
Sizing before Purchase
To fit for your proper sized helmet you will need a soft tape measure. Take this tape measure and have another person snugly wrap it around your head at the largest point, usually just above the eyebrows (see left). Record this measurement of circumference and compare it to the available sizing charts in the brand of helmet you are looking at.
Sizing after Purchase
To ensure a good fit after you have received your proper sized helmet, flip open and unlock the helmet clip(s) and slide the helmet to its last and largest setting. Position it on the head so the rim is one finger width above the eyebrow. Gradually begin to downsize the helmet, pressing on the front and back until a comfortable, snug fit is achieved. Lock the helmet into this size by pressing down and closing the locking adjustment(s). Look in a mirror while wearing the helmet to make sure the ear guards are covering at least half of your ear and to make sure the helmet does not appear to be shifting back and forth on your head.
It is recommended to use a mouth guard although not required. It is recommended that players wear HECC and CE Certified helmets and in Hockey Canada sanctioned leagues it is required for helmets to be CSA approved. CSA, HECC and CE Certified stickers are fixed to the helmets indicating their certification.
